APPLICANT MUST MEET THE FOLLOWING CRITERIA SET BY OUR INSURANCE CARRIER IN ORDER TO DRIVE A COMPANY VEHICLE:

(If applicant checks “No” to any of the following questions, applicant is not eligible for hire) Yes ____ No ____ Is Applicant a minimum Age of 21 years?

Yes ____ No ____ Does Applicant have a valid driver’s license (not suspended)?

Yes ____ No ____ Does Applicant have an acceptable driving record?

An “acceptable driving record” as defined by our insurance carrier criteria includes no violations for DWI, DUI, OWI, OUT, refusing substance test, reckless driving, manslaughter, hit &run, eluding a police office, any felony, drag racing, license suspension, driving while license suspended, etc., for the previous 5 years. It also includes no more than one moving violation, which includes all vehicle accidents, speeding, improper lane change, failure to yield, running red lights or stop lights, etc., in the previous 3 years.

Invitation to Self-Identify for Protected Veterans As an EEO/AA employer, GESI, Inc. is subject to the Vietnam Era Veterans’ Readjustment Assistance Act of 1974 (VEVRAA) which requires government contractors to take affirmative action to employ and advance veterans in employment. VEVRAA prohibits discrimination and requires affirmative action in all personnel practices regarding protected veterans. The statute covers disabled veterans, Armed Forces service medal veterans, recently separated veterans, and other veterans who served during a war, or in campaign or expedition for which a campaign badge has been authorized.

Employee Name (printed): _________________________________ Date: __________________ Employee Signature: ___________________________________________________________ VETERAN CATEGORY DEFINITIONS: Disabled Veteran: a veteran of the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service who is entitled to compensation (or who but for the receipt of military retired pay would be entitled to compensation) under laws administered by the Secretary of Veterans Affairs, or a person who was discharged or released from active duty because of a service-connected disability. Special Disabled Veteran: a veteran of the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service who is entitled to compensation (or who but for the receipt of military retired pay would be entitled to compensation) under laws administered by the Department of Veterans' Affairs for a disability (A) rated at 30 percent or more, or (B) rated at 10 or 20 percent in the case of a veteran who has been determined under Section 38 U.S.C. 3106 to have a serious employment handicap or (ii) a person who was discharged or released from active duty because of a service connected disability. Veteran of the Vietnam era: a person who: served on active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service for a period of more than 180 days, and who was discharged or released there from with other than a dishonorable discharge, if any part of such active duty was performed: (A) in the Republic of Vietnam between February 28, 1961, and May 7, 1975; or (B) between August 5, 1964, and May 7, 1975, in all other cases; or was discharged or released from active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service for a service connected disability if any part of such active duty was performed (A) in the Republic of Vietnam between February 28, 1961, and May 7, 1975; or (B) between August 5, 1964, and May 7, 1975, in any other location.

How do I know if I have a disability?

You are considered to have a disability if you have a physical or mental impairment or medical condition that

substantially limits a major life activity, or if you have a history or record of such an impairment or medical

condition.

Disabilities include, but are not limited to:

Blindness

Deafness Cancer Diabetes

Epilepsy

Autism

Cerebral palsy

HIV/AIDS

Schizophrenia

Muscular dystrophy

Bipolar disorder

Major depression

Multiple sclerosis (MS)

Missing limbs or partially missing limbs

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) Obsessive compulsive disorder Impairments requiring the use of a wheelchair

Intellectual disability (previously called mental retardation)

Reasonable Accommodation Notice

Federal law requires employers to provide reasonable accommodation to qualified individuals with disabilities.

Please tell us if you require a reasonable accommodation to apply for a job or to perform your job. Examples

of reasonable accommodation include making a change to the application process or work procedures,

providing documents in an alternate format, using a sign language interpreter, or using specialized equipment.
